      Kanosuke Double Distillery
      Two Voices, One Elemental Song

      To appreciate this whisky is to appreciate the nuance of process. Kanosuke employs three pot stills of differing shapes and neck designs - a rarity in Japanese whisky - allowing for remarkable variation even within a single malt regime. Double Distillery draws from two of these stills, each producing a different style of new make spirit: one rich and muscular, the other lighter, more aromatic.

      The result is a single malt that feels like a conversation - not clashing, but conversing. A whisky with breadth, but also direction.

      On the nose, it opens with an aromatic richness - steamed rice, roasted barley, and a touch of fig jam. Then come the coastal notes, true to its Kagoshima home: sea salt, wet sand, a trace of sun-dried driftwood. There's an underlying sweetness too - brown sugar, orange oil, and the whisper of sandalwood incense that seems to trail through every Kanosuke dram like a signature.

      The palate is where the dialogue comes alive. At first sip: bitter chocolate, dried apricot, and toasted cereal. Then it brightens - a lift of green apple peel, ginger, and a flicker of menthol. The mouthfeel is creamy yet structured, suggesting careful oak management - likely a mix of bourbon casks and possibly some shochu cask influence, offering that distinctive rounded umami edge.

      The finish is elongated and elegant - black tea, white pepper, and a mellow note of earthy sweetness, like kinako-dusted mochi or chestnut honey. It lingers without heaviness, and fades like a final verse spoken just beneath your breath.
